Description

A military bunker located in Rome, Italy, originally constructed between November 1940 and June 1943 to protect Italy's former royal family, the House of Savoy, during World War II air raids. The underground structure, situated within Villa Ada park, spans over 200 square meters and features a circular plan with seven rooms including main chambers, bathrooms, an antechamber, and service areas. After more than five years of closure, the historic bunker has reopened to the public for guided tours, offering insight into Italy's wartime defensive preparations and royal heritage.
